GOODLETTSVILLE, Tenn. (WTVF) — There's a lot going on at Goodlettsville Elementary School. Besides the students working on writing and arithmetic, there's quite a bit of reading going on as well.

Local adults, volunteer to take at least 30 minutes out of one day a week, to stop by and read to the children. The program is now in it's 25th year, and the volunteers love it as much as the students do.

Literacy, student achievement and positive behavior are just a few of the results that happen when children are read to. And the volunteers say, it gives them a sense of purpose knowing that the students are learning, and appreciating those adults who take their time to stop by.
